Technically Dirrell is faster and and has a better punch variety than Pascal and Taylor but its how he copes with the pressure late in the fight.
Froch will be outspeeded early and its then upto Dirrell to maintain because Froch will get stronger as the fight wears on and Dirrel will more than likely get more tired. Id pick Dirrell against Froch because the hand speed disparity is ridiculous and on the Taylor showing i dont think Froch is as hard a puncher at World level that he was at domestic. Either Froch's experience wins out over a longer fight, or Dirrell comes of age. Its worth pointing out that Pascal was not hurt by Froch but he was hurt by Omar Pittman and Diaconu. |
